Bielby Music Festival 2014 Money Raised And Thanks

The festival raised £1350 for Marie Curie Cancer Care. Well done and thanks to all involved and especially to those who helped set up and dismantle the festival field, and also thanks to Matt and Jenny for the loan of the field.

Ian has emailed with the final total raised from 2013 music festival.
This is an excerpt of a letter from Val, Marie Curie Cancer Care treasurer at Pocklington Branch.
 
"Thank-you for your cheque which we received yesterday and have banked to day

Here is the breakdown of monies banked:
 
£320.00  B.B.Q
 
£113.00  CAFE

£220.54  Sales of unsold Meat and bread
 
£650.00 chq. from I Simpson (cash on door)
 
£687.85  "         "           "  (cash on door)
 
£285.00 Donations and cheques on the day
 
£36.00   Name the Teddy
 
£33.00  Face Painting
 ________
£ 2345.39
£405.00 - Less meat and bread cost

£1940.39 OUR FINAL TOTAL for Marie Curie Cancer Care
 
 Thank-you again for raising this amount of money."
